- Public Joint-Stock Company Krasnyj Octyabr engages in the production and sale of confectionery products in Russia; its core offerings include chocolate and chocolate products, candy boxes, caramel, marmalade, hard-boiled sweets, toffees, cocoa powder, nuts, and half-finished chocolate products. Founded in 1867 and headquartered in Moscow at Ulitsa Malaya Krasnoselskaya, 7, building 24, the company operates primarily within the Russian market, employing approximately 2,941 people and focusing on the consumer defensive sector as a key confectionery manufacturer. It maintains branches in locations such as Ryazan, Kolomna, and Egorevsk, with production supported by advanced equipment from international partners including Austrian firm Haas for mechanized candy lines and Swiss group Buler for chocolate mass processing.
